Transcosmos, Japan-based company providing high value-added services has collaborated with Bodygram, AI body sizing Technology and it began selling Bodygram solution. The Transcosmos’ website support all the channels connecting companies and consumers from the web to offline through its Outsourcing services.

Bodygram is an advanced technology that predicts users’ body size with the use of deep learning model, a subset of artificial intelligence (AI). All users need to do is to enter their age, height, weight, and gender, and take two photos, one front, and one side, with their clothes on via a smartphone. Then Bodygram automatically detects the users’ body shape and takes an accurate measurement of the different areas of their body including waist, shoulder width, arm length, and leg length with a margin of error of only plus or minus one centimeter, according to a press release by Transcosmos.

With this new partnership agreement in place, Transcosmos has set up a dedicated Bodygram team that provides end-to-end services including development, operations, analytics, and other support services related to Bodygram, an AI-powered measurement technology owned by Bodygram.

Transcosmos not only sells Bodygram but also delivers value-added services such as a support service for embedding the technology in business applications and analytics services for converting body measurement data into knowledge. What’s more, in partnership with Bodygram Japan, Transcosmos will create new businesses based on assumed use cases that are specific to each industry.
